Opportunities for Agencies in Fuerteventura: Insights from Seller Mandates

Summary of the Announcement

The real estate sector is currently facing significant challenges in property acquisition. Whereas finding buyers used to be the primary concern, many agencies now agree that the real hurdle lies in securing new properties to market. To address this shift, tools that facilitate connections with potential sellers are proving essential. One such tool is the “Mandatos de Vendedor” from Fotocasa Pro, designed to help agencies engage with homeowners who are contemplating putting their properties up for sale.

Agency representatives are illustrating how this service can enhance their property acquisition efforts. A notable example is La Home Inmobiliaria in La Cañada, Valencia, where the introduction of Mandatos de Vendedor has begun to yield impressive results. Initial feedback from agencies indicates that being proactive in reaching out to interested sellers can significantly streamline the property acquisition process.
